Bihar, August 16th, 2022: Earlier this month, Nitish Kumar had snapped ties with BJP and was sworn in as the Bihar Chief Minister for the eighth time with the leader of the RJD party, Tejashwi Yadav as his deputy.

Nitish Kumar expanded his cabinet this morning with the majority of the seats being allocated to RJD legislators.

16 ministers were sworn from RDJ, whereas 11 ministers took oath from Kumar’s JD(U) party and two ministers from Congress.

Tej Pratap Yadav, Tejashwi’s brother, and ex-CM Lalu Prasad Yadav’s elder son was also sworn in today.

Two legislators from Congress, one from Jitin Ram Manjhi’s Hindustani Awam Morcha, Santosh Suman, and the lone Independent MLA, Sumit Kumar Singh, will also take oath.

Other RDJ ministers like Alok Mehta, Lalit Yadav, Surendra Yadav, and Kumar Sarvjeet are also expected to take oath at the Raj Bhawan today.

While the Bihar cabinet can have up to 36 ministers, few seats are being left vacated for future expansion.

The new Nitish Kumar-led-Mahagathbandhan government will undergo a floor test to prove its majority in the state assembly on August 24th,2022.
